About Yashuo Chen

Yashuo Chen is a scholar working on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, Social Psychology and Modeling and Simulation, having authored 10 papers that have together received 427 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Job Satisfaction and Organizational Behavior (8 papers), Cultural Differences and Values (3 papers) and Customer Service Quality and Loyalty (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management (157 citations), Human Factors and Ergonomics (20 citations) and Clinical Psychology (162 citations). Yashuo Chen has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Chunjiang Yang, Xinyuan Zhao, Nan Hua, Anna S. Mattila, Jijun Gao, Aobo Chen, Zhen Zhou, Chen‐Bo Zhong, Li Miao and Shibin Wang. Their work appears in journals such as PLoS ONE, Frontiers in Psychology and International Journal of Hospitality Management.
